Do your Research
When writing an essay, you support your argument with evidence. To find this relevant support for your case, you research your topic thoroughly. The same rule applies to finance.
Many students enter into university on the back of homely comforts and blissful ignorance. Completely unaware of the realistic cost of living, the proverbial penny (if you can spare it) drops about halfway through the first year.
There is that overwhelming, sinking sensation in the pit of your stomach when you finally check your bank account. Panic hits when you discover you have already used up this month’s instalment of your student loan as well as the next two payments.
This gut-wrenching feeling can easily be avoided if you do your research. Know what to expect and it’ll cushion the blow.
